What Is Dead Man’s Switch?
Dead Man’s Switch is one of the teachable perks that can be unlocked for all characters from level 35. This perk is unique to The Deathslinger that is a killer introduced in the Chapter XV: Chains of Hate on March 10, 2020.
Dead Man’s Switch is a common feature that is found on heavy machinery in which a switch should be held continuously, so that a machine will keep operating. As long as any one of them decides to stop repairing during the activation window, Dead Man’s Switch perk works to block Generators that are repaired by multiple Survivors,
How Does Dead Man’s Switch Work?
When using this teachable perk, you will be obsessed with one survivor. Once you hook the Obsession, the Dead Man’s Switch will activate for the next 35, 40 or 45 seconds. While you activate this perk, any survivor stopping to repair a Generator before this perk is fully repaired will cause the Entity to block the generator until the perk’s effect ends.
Furthermore, the generators that are affected will be highlighted by a white Aura. So, you can only be obsessed with one Survive at a time. For more information, the Dead Man’s Switch may be unlocked in The Deathslinger’s Bloodweb at level 35 or in the Shrine of Secrets.
The Cost of Dead Man’s Switch
Dead Man’s Switch has some different costs, depending on the rarity. Here are the cost of Dead Man’s Switch:
-
- Uncommon Rarity: Dead Man’s Switch costs 4,000 Bloodpoints
- Rare Rarity: Dead Man’s Switch costs 5,000 Bloodpoints
- Very Rare Rarity: Dead Man’s Switch costs 6,000 Bloodpoints
- Event Rarity : Dead Man’s Switch costs 5,000 Bloodpoints
- Artifact Rarity: Dead Man’s Switch costs 2,000 Bloodpoints
